文字マッピングテーブルメソッドの Java からの呼び出し方
Javaでは、HashMapを使って文字のマッピングテーブルを実装して、getメソッドを呼び出して対応する文字のマッピング値を取得できます。以下にサンプルコードを示します。
import java.util.HashMap;
public class CharMappingTable {
public static void main(String[] args) {
// 创建字符映射表
HashMap<Character, String> mappingTable = new HashMap<>();
// 添加映射关系
mappingTable.put('A', "Apple");
mappingTable.put('B', "Banana");
mappingTable.put('C', "Cat");
// 获取字符'A'的映射值
String mappingValue = mappingTable.get('A');
System.out.println("Mapping value of 'A': " + mappingValue);
// 获取字符'C'的映射值
mappingValue = mappingTable.get('C');
System.out.println("Mapping value of 'C': " + mappingValue);
// 获取字符'D'的映射值(不存在的映射关系)
mappingValue = mappingTable.get('D');
System.out.println("Mapping value of 'D': " + mappingValue);
}
}
上記のコードを実行すると次が出力されます:
Mapping value of 'A': Apple
Mapping value of 'C': Cat
Mapping value of 'D': null
なお、マッピングテーブルにマッピング関係のない文字列を取得する場合は、getメソッドはnullを返します。